首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Pandas中添加新DataFrame列不起作用

可能是由于以下几个原因:

  1. 语法错误:请确保在添加新列时使用正确的语法。在Pandas中,可以使用以下方式添加新列:
  2. 语法错误:请确保在添加新列时使用正确的语法。在Pandas中,可以使用以下方式添加新列:
  3. 其中,df是DataFrame对象,new_column是新列的名称,values是要添加的值。
  4. 未重新赋值:在Pandas中,添加新列后需要将结果重新赋值给原始DataFrame对象,以使更改生效。例如:
  5. 未重新赋值:在Pandas中,添加新列后需要将结果重新赋值给原始DataFrame对象,以使更改生效。例如:
  6. 列名不存在:如果尝试添加的列名在DataFrame中不存在,将无法成功添加新列。请确保列名正确且与DataFrame中的列名匹配。
  7. 数据类型不匹配:如果尝试添加的值的数据类型与DataFrame中其他列的数据类型不匹配,可能会导致添加新列不起作用。请确保值的数据类型与DataFrame中其他列的数据类型一致。

如果以上方法仍然无法解决问题,可以尝试检查Pandas的版本是否过旧,或者查阅Pandas官方文档以获取更多帮助和解决方案。

Pandas是一个功能强大的数据分析和处理库,适用于数据清洗、转换、分析和可视化等任务。它提供了灵活的数据结构和丰富的函数,使得数据处理变得更加简单和高效。

推荐的腾讯云相关产品:腾讯云服务器(CVM)和腾讯云数据库(TencentDB)。腾讯云服务器提供可扩展的计算能力,适用于部署和运行各种应用程序。腾讯云数据库提供可靠的数据存储和管理解决方案,支持多种数据库引擎和数据备份机制。

腾讯云服务器(CVM)产品介绍链接:https://cloud.tencent.com/product/cvm 腾讯云数据库(TencentDB)产品介绍链接:https://cloud.tencent.com/product/cdb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分7秒

PS小白教程:如何在Photoshop中给风景照添加光线效果?

1分28秒

PS小白教程:如何在Photoshop中制作出镂空文字?

1分10秒

PS小白教程:如何在Photoshop中制作透明玻璃效果?

领券